This was in my 94' RT/10 with about 68,000 miles on it. This was back around February of 06'.

Mods:
Dynomax Mufflers
No cats
Short Throw shifter
K&N "Cone Type" intake filters
A/C Pully bypassed

Weather:
San Antonio Texas, so low altitude, cool around 65-70 degrees, very low humidity.

Things against me:
Strong direct headwind
Broken motor mount (didn't realize it at the time)
Near bald and hard Pilot street tires
Shifted at 6,000RPM when I should have been shifting at 5,300. MAJOR power loss after 5,500RPM according to my Dyno results, so I was losing out big time by shifting too high.
